1 � <br /> M E M O R A N D U M <br /> CALIFORNIA REGIONAL WATER QUALITY CONTROL BOARD - CENTRAL VALLEY REGION <br /> 3443 R outier R oad Phone: (916) 361-5600 <br /> Sac=entD, CA 95827-3098 AT SS:8-495-5600 <br /> TO: Gary A. Reents . FROM: John J. Tomko <br /> t � <br /> DATE: 14 April 1989 SIGNATURE: <br /> SUBJECT: Southwest Hide Company - Site Characterization and Report of <br /> Waste Discharge <br /> On 11 April 1989 we received the following reports from Southwest Hide <br /> Company, prepared by their consultant Moldenhauer Engineering Company: <br /> - Report of Waste Discharge, Subchapter 15 <br /> Informational Requirements <br /> - Site Characterization Report <br /> - Appendix to the Site Characterization Report <br /> The Report of Waste Discharge was not reviewed since the discharger is <br /> planning to abandon the existing waste disposal system. The replacement <br /> of the existing waste ponds with a brine recycling system was first <br /> discussed at the 2 February 1989 meeting with the discharger's <br /> consultant, Moldenhauer Engineering Company. The Site Characterization <br /> Report estimates an October 1989 completion date for the abandonment and <br /> closure of the waste ponds, and the full scale operation of the brine <br /> recycling system. <br /> The time line in the Site Characterization Report for the brine <br /> recycling system includes interim dates for letter reports regarding <br /> the operational states of the pilot model (May 1989) , and the No. 1 Unit <br /> (June 1989) . These letter reports should be submitted to this office. <br /> Proprietary information can be deleted from these letter reports, <br /> providing that sufficient information is submitted to demonstrate that <br /> the project is proceeding on schedule. <br /> As noted in the Moldenhauer Engineering Company cover letter to the <br /> Report of Waste Discharge report, if the decision is made that the brine <br /> recycling system is not feasible, then an update to the Report of Waste <br /> Discharge will be necessary.
